Dundee 0 Queen Of the South 0, Dens Park, First Division, 14/November/09

Top of the table clash at Dens on Saturday turned into a dull 0-0 draw. Which keeps Queens top on goal difference. Dundee without Leigh Griffiths and Brian Kerr. With Colin McMenamin replaced by Pat Clarke who started his first game. Colin Cameron came into midfield. It was Cameron who's shot over the bar in the first half of few chances. Queens were happy to sit in and take the draw. Dundee created the better of the chances throughout, although they rarely troubled keeper David Hutton. It took almost an hour before Hutton was called on to make a save, when a superb through ball from Gary Harkins deserved more from Craig Forsyth.It was pretty poor stuff and we will have to play a lot better next week at Perth in the Alba Cup Final.. 

Dundee: Douglas, Paton, Malone, McHale (Hart 60), MacKenzie, Lauchlan, Forsyth, Cameron, Clarke (McMenamin 76), Higgins, Harkins. Subs Not Used: Soutar, Benedictus, Rennie.

Att: 4,901
